PHP sumar horas

Nolberto
15 de Octubre del 2003
Saludos,

Estoy aprendiendo a programar en PHP gracias a estos cursos y foros. Me he tropezado con lo siguiente.

He buscado en los FAQs de diferentes paginas en internet y no he encontrado solucion a mi problema, tengo el codigo:

<?
$hora = date("H:i");
$otrahora = date("H:i");
$result = $hora + $otrahora;
echo $result;
?>

El resultado que me muestra es: 16, teniendo en cuenta que son las 8:25 a.m.

El resultado que espero es 16:50. Es posible dar ese resultado por operacion entre variables directamente? como puedo hacerlo? sí no se puede hacer directamente cual seria el metodo para llevarlo a cabo?


De antemano gracias a cualquier persona que me pueda colaborar.

Hasta pronto.

Nolberto Gaviria

pablo
15 de Octubre del 2003
//esto te va ha servir....
$hora_en_milisegundos = 3600;
$time = time();
$time = $time + $hora_en_milisegundos;
echo $result = date("H:i",$time)

Nolberto
15 de Octubre del 2003
Gracias Pablo, ha funcionado!
Hasta luego y que tengas suertes!!!

Oliverio
15 de Octubre del 2003
OJo! una hora tiene 3600 SEGUNDOS, no milisegundos